In practice, a common way to value a share of stock when a company pays dividends is to value the dividends over the next five years or so, then find the "terminal" stock price using a benchmark PE ratio. Suppose a company just paid a dividend of $1.17. The dividends are expected to grow at 12 percent over the next five years. The company has a payout ratio of 40 percent and a benchmark PE of 19. The required return is 12 percent. What is the target stock price in five years?

Which of the following statements about the cost of capital is incorrect? Select one: a. A company's target capital structure affects its weighted average cost of capital. b. Weighted average cost of capital calculations should be based on the after-tax-costs of all the individual capital components. c. If a company's tax rate increases, then, all else equal, its weighted average cost of capital will increase. d. The cost of retained earnings is equal to the return stockholders could earn on alternative investments of equal risk. e. Flotation costs can increase the cost of preferred stock.

Answers

Answer:

c. If a company's tax rate increases, then, all else equal, its weighted average cost of capital will increase.

Explanation:

We will analize based on the WACC formula:

[tex]WACC = K_e(\frac{E}{E+D}) + K_d(1-t)(\frac{D}{E+D})[/tex]

(C) Incorrect, if the tax-rate increase, notice the cost of debt tax-shield will be higher, therefore it will generate a lower WACC

asumming a debt cost of 10%

if the tax-rate is 20%  10% ( 1 - 20%) = 8%

if the tax-rate is 50%  10% ( 1 - 50%) =5%

the cost of debt is lower, thus the WACC will be lower to.

Bank 1 lends funds at a nominal rate of 8% with payments to be made semiannually. Bank 2 requires payments to be made quarterly. If Bank 2 would like to charge the same effective annual rate as Bank 1, what nominal annual rate will they charge their customers? Round your answer to three decimal places. Do not round intermediate calculations.

Answers

Answer: 7.922%

Explanation:

Bank 1 lends at nominal rate of 8% and payments made is semiannually,

So,

Semiannual rate of bank 1 = 4%

Effective annual rate of Bank 1:

[tex]EAR=(1+half\ yearly\ rate)^{2}-1[/tex]

[tex]EAR=(1+0.04)^{2}-1[/tex]

= 8.16%

If Bank 2 wants to maintain the same level of EAR at quarterly compounding:

[tex](1+quarterly\ rate)^{4} =EAR+1[/tex]

[tex](1+quarterly\ rate)^{4} =8.16\ percent+1[/tex]

[tex](1+quarterly\ rate)^{4} =1.0816[/tex]

[tex](1+quarterly\ rate) =(1.0816)^{\frac{1}{4} }[/tex]

[tex](1+quarterly\ rate) =1.01980390271[/tex]

Quarterly rate = 1.01980390271 - 1

                       = 1.980390%

Nominal annual rate for Bank 2 = Quarterly rate × 4

                                                       = 1.980390% × 4

                                                       = 7.9215% or 7.922%

The Smelting Department of Kiner Company has the following production data for November. Production: Beginning work in process 3,700 units that are 100% complete as to materials and 29% complete as to conversion costs; units transferred out 9,300 units; and ending work in process 9,100 units that are 100% complete as to materials and 40% complete as to conversion costs. Compute the equivalent units of production for (a) materials and (b) conversion costs for the month of Novomber.

Answers

Answer:

(A) 18,400 units

(B) 12,940 units

Explanation:

The computation of the equivalent units of production for

(A) Material =  Units transferred out +  Ending work in process

                   = 9,300 units + 9,100 units

                   = 18,400 units

(B) Conversion  =  Units transferred out +  (Ending work in process × conversion percentage)

= 9,300 units + 9,100 units × 40%

= 9,300 units + 3,640 units

= 12,940 units

Wims, Inc., has sales of $15.2 million, total assets of $9.8 million, and total debt of $3.7 million. The profit margin is 6 percent. a. What is net income? (Do not round intermediate calculations and enter your answer in dollars, not millions, rounded to the nearest whole number, e.g., 1,234,567.) b. What is ROA? (Do not round intermediate calculations and enter your answer as a percent rounded to 2 decimal places, e.g., 32.16.) c. What is ROE?

Answers

a. The Net Income is $912,000.

b. The Return on Assets (ROA) is 9.31%.

c. The Return on Equity (ROE) is 14.98%.

a. Net Income: To determine the net income, we use the given sales and profit margin to find the amount after deducting expenses.

Net Income = Sales × Profit Margin

Net Income = $15,200,000 × 0.06

Net Income = $912,000

b. Return on Assets (ROA): ROA is computed by dividing net income by total assets, showcasing how efficiently assets generate earnings.

ROA = Net Income / Total Assets

ROA = $912,000 / $9,800,000

ROA = 0.0931 or 9.31%

c. Return on Equity (ROE): ROE is calculated by dividing net income by total equity, demonstrating the returns generated on shareholders' investments.

ROE = Net Income / Total Equity

Total Equity = Total Assets - Total Debt

Total Equity = $9,800,000 - $3,700,000

Total Equity = $6,100,000

ROE = $912,000 / $6,100,000

ROE = 0.1498 or 14.98%

Therefore, the answers are:

a. Net Income: $912,000

b. ROA: 9.31%

c. ROE: 14.98%
